my E70 X5 diesel -DPF/SCR/EGR/DEF Delete (with video)

I have an e70 x5 diesel - US (canadian) spec and decided to remove the DPF, DEF, EGR, SCR and replace it with a custom catted DPF Delete pipe and another pipe to remove the larger cat.

At the same time, I wanted to completely remove the EGR so I had some brackets fabricated and made a kit to bypass the coolant. I now don't have to worry about my EGR leaking

Anyways, here's a vid of the first startup.

This is what it sounded like with just the DPF delete pipe (with small cat)
This was my first startup.

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=IvK1nd1x5bw


Here is a vid of it all back together.
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=j_95Ljmrgsg

It isn't loud.. in fact, its much quieter than I thought it would be. The only difference is you hear the turbos in the exhaust.

Its about -15 when I took the 2nd video (this morning)
It doesn't really smoke.. The only smoke you'd see is the small amount you see at the 1:05 mark.


I live in Alberta, canada and we don't have emissions. If we did I'm sure it'll at least be a few years down the road and worst case scenario I part it out. Best case, we never get emissions. I'm not concerned.
